Frosted Meltaway Cookies
By srumbel
A delicious light and buttery cookie that literally melts in your mouth.

Ingredients
- Frosting:
- 1/2 cup cornstarch
- 1/2 cup powdered sugar
- 3/4 cup butter, room temperature
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up margarine or butter, softened
- 1/4 cup milk
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 4 cups powdered sugar (more or less depending on how thick/runny you like it)
Details
Preparation time 10mins
Cooking time 25mins
Preparation
Step 1
In a medium-sized bowl, cream butter and powdered sugar together. Add vanilla. Add in flour and cornstarch; mix well.
Place dough in the refrigerator for 45-60 minutes.
Preheat oven to 300 degrees.
Roll dough into 1" balls and place on a cookie sheet. Flatten each ball by gently pressing the bottom of a glass on each cookie (dip the bottom of the glass in powdered sugar first to prevent it from sticking to the bottom of a cookie). Bake for 15-20 minutes or until the edges are slightly golden- be sure not to overbake these cookies!
Let cookies cool for 5-10 minutes on their pan, then carefully remove them (I just put them on a plate, but you could put them on a wire rack). These cookies are very delicate, so handle carefully.
In a medium bowl, mix together the frosting ingredients until well-blended and frost each cookie.
Serves: 36 cookies
